Cockburn Sound tested for contamination from toxic firefighting chemicals

Press/Media: Press / Media

Description

The waters of Cockburn Sound south of Perth are being tested for potential contamination by toxic firefighting chemicals used at the HMAS Stirling navy base last decade.
The Department of Environment Regulation (DER) began to test for perfluorinated chemicals in response to a Department of Defence report highlighting high levels of contamination at HMAS Stirling on Garden Island.
